Q: Is 185,122 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 185,122 is a composite number.

Why is 185,122 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 185,122 can be evenly divided by 1 2 7 14 49 98 1,889 3,778 13,223 26,446 92,561 and 185,122, with no remainder.

Since 185,122 cannot be divided by just 1 and 185,122, it is a composite number.
